For the past year, I stuck to my New Year’s resolution and read a book a week which equated to reading over 52 books. The experience changed my life in a variety of ways, some less apparent than others. I mention the struggles and relay my tips so others can achieve the same. In addition, I share the best books that I’ve read over the year.

What’s your favorite book written by a chef? Do you have a favorite Bourdain book? I finished kitchen confidential last month. Thanx for posting
@Jamesnu
@Jamesnu Год назад
Thanks for watching! Kitchen Confidential is definitely a classic. I also liked Bourdain's follow-up Medium Raw, but Kitchen Confidential is still probably his best. It's hard to narrow down my absolute favorite work by a chef, but I did like Heat, by Bill Buford. David Chang's book Eat a Peach was enjoyable as well and I liked Jacques Pépin's book The Apprentice. There's a lot of good ones out there!
